THE STORY OF JESUS: 2 Kings 1-4
“‘Let me inherit a double portion of your spirit,’ Elisha replied.”
Elijah and Elisha were some of Israel’s greatest prophets, backed by God’s power.
The miracles they performed confirm that they have God’s Spirit and speak for God.
If God supports His old covenant messengers, how much more will He support us.
Jesus calls His followers greater than the greatest OT prophet (Matthew 11:11).
We have received the fullness of the Spirit of Jesus, anointing us as His prophets.
The Spirit of Jesus will work through our weak efforts, to give them impact.
Elijah, Elisha, John, and us, we’re all ordinary servants of God.
But when we speak and act in Jesus’ Name, amazing things happen.
As a Jesus follower, are you feeling confident to speak and act for God?
We should not look to these prophets for examples of being God’s prophets.
Jesus has show us what a God-pleasing ‘servant of God’ looks like.
Not being pushy or arrogant, but humbly, boldly showing and sharing His love!
We have more than a double portion of Elisha’s Spirit, ready to work through us.
Are we as eager as Elisha to be filled with the Spirit of Jesus in our lives?
What do you sense the Lord saying to you?
PRAYER
Lord, You have given us the Spirit of boldness and love, may we not let the spirit of doubt silence or stop us from being channels of Your grace!
